Some Important Habits to Avoid or Change

Say No to Smoking, Alcohol, and Drugs –Try to restrict yourself from all of them before planning a baby, and if you are unable to do so, then get help from your health care provider or gynaecologist in Singapore to quit or reduce their influence.

Keep Yourself Healthy with Exercise – If you wish to ensure the hassle-free arrival of the newborn, then you must exercise several times a week. You can speak to your instructor or health care professional about various exercises and workout routines that you can follow to stay light and fit.

Eat the Right Foods - Eating too much junk or unhealthy food may not help your baby to grow and stay healthy. It is advisable to eat fresh fruits, leafy vegetables, and milk products in abundance while you’re pregnant to contribute towards your baby’s growth and healthiness.

What about Prenatal Care?

The care is highly important during your entire pregnancy period, get in touch with some experienced healthcare professionals and seek their help on the following matters:
        Learning more about pregnancy, challenges you may face, and how to prepare yourself for labor and birth.
        Advise with eating healthier foods and exercise routines
        Routine checkups and tests to ensure that the baby is doing well
        Treatment for any recent or existing health problems
        Help with quitting smoking or drinking.

Why do You Need Prenatal Care?

It goes without saying that prenatal care helps you have a healthier and more risk-free delivery. Following the advice of healthcare professionals helps the baby and the mother to stay healthy during pregnancy. It also helps to reduce the risks of harm to the baby, ensures that you feel better and stay positive during the crucial pregnancy months, and offers solutions to certain problems that can happen throughout your pregnancy.
